Я пытаюсь создать простую игру-змейку в качестве простого первого проекта с использованием SFML на c ++, однако программа вылетает.
Я попытался повторить все конфигурации в Visual Studio, и я попытался отладить с помощью укладчика. (Не знаю, как правильно его использовать, поэтому не очень хорошо.)
Вот мой код:
#include <SFML/Window.hpp> //Loads SFML Windowfile
using namespace std; //Includes sf for Window and VideoMode
int main()
{
Window window(VideoMode(500,500), "My window"); //Creates a window and assigns it a size and name
return 0;
}
Я также пробовал этот код безуспешно:
#include <SFML/Window.hpp>
int main()
{
sf::Window window;
window.create(sf::VideoMode(800, 600), "My window");
return 0;
}
Я ожидаю получить окно размером 500 x 500 пикселей, но вместо этого получаю следующее сообщение об ошибке: «Необработанное исключение в 0x000B3062 в Snake3.exe: 0xC0000005: Место записи нарушения доступа 0x00000079». и это указывает мне на xmemmory0.
Вот стэк вызовов